Steady-state stability assessment of AC-busbar plug-in electric vehicle charging station with photovoltaic
Although the deployment of alternating current (AC) -busbar plug-in electric vehicle (PEV) charging station with photovoltaic (PV) is a promising alternative, the interaction among subsystems always causes the instability problem.
